Transaction 50cc81dd55d2b63778254f302c3cb1018fb15298465f0eee9cc7bacf44445837
1 Input
1 Output
-
50cc81dd55d2b63778254f302c3cb1018fb15298465f0eee9cc7bacf44445837:0
- value
- 40355
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a6e4d5091926952eaa830c3d3593dd47ee2a52 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17oiwBk6LnhbTvEDxQhQyxwPF8jmstnGyf